Frontrunners including Vermont Sen. Bernie Sanders, South Bend, Indiana, Mayor Pete Buttigieg and Sen. Elizabeth Warren are set to appear during the first July 30 debate.

Sen. Kamala Harris and former Vice President Joe Biden speak as Sen. Bernie Sanders looks on during the second night of the first Democratic presidential debate on June 27, 2019 in Miami, Florida.Former Vice President Joe Biden and California Sen. Kamala Harris are set to face off again in the second round of Democratic presidential primary debates on July 31.

The rematch comes on the second of two nights of debates, when groups of 10 Democrats vying to unseat President Donald Trump will take the stage in Detroit to lay out their agendas for 2020. The events will be broadcast live on CNN.she tore into Biden over his comments on the campaign trailBut the marquee matchup between Biden, who has maintained a steady lead in the polls, and Harris, who made gains after her first debate performance, is hardly the only one to watch.

Frontrunners including Vermont Sen. Bernie Sanders, South Bend, Indiana, Mayor Pete Buttigieg and Sen. Elizabeth Warren will participate in the first half of the debate, on July 30.
